I solved my modem problem yesterday by using pppconfig instead of the GUI one Ubuntu provides, I'm not sure whats wrong with it, but something is definatly broken.
I'm not sure if ubuntu comes with pppconfig by default (I downloaded it and installed it before checking) if not I used the package from http://packages.debian.org/stable/base/pppconfig
I then installed the package and used it, just as easy as the GUI to setup, and all you need to use are pon <name of connection> and poff <name> and all works wonderfully :)
I'm also reasonably sure you can set one of your connections as default and then all you have to type is pon or poff (without the name of connection) -- Cameron
